Pacific Air Forces is collecting gifts and presents for the 53rd installment of Operation Christmas Drop across the Pacific islands. Called the longest running, organization airdrop in the world by Stars and Stripes, the event is set to kick off on Dec. 4 and will conclude on Dec. 6 after three C-130s of the 36th Airlift Squadron at Andersen AFB, Guam, complete drops over 55 islands in the Federated States of Micronesia, Palau, and the Northern Marianas.
